Section 107.131 - Conveyance or release of contingent or expectant interests.

OR Rev Stat § 107.131 (2015) What's This?

In addition to the revocation of designation of beneficiary under ORS 107.121, a judgment of dissolution, separation or annulment may require conveyance or release of contingent or expectant interests, including right of survivorship, that are necessary to effectuate a division of assets between the principal and the spouse in the marital dissolution, separation or annulment.

[2005 c.285 §6]
